Grape seed is known for its antioxidant properties. Grape seed extract, the extract of grape seeds has been studied for antioxidant and cardiovascular properties, as well as for many other health conditions such as venous insufficiency and ophthalmologic disorders.

Grape seed extract is a nutrient primarily derived from the seeds of grapes but is found in the skin and stems. It has powerful antioxidant properties and has protective compounds known as flavonoids. These include oligomeric proanthocyanidins (OPCs), quercetin, catechin, ellagic acid and reveratrol, which are also found in red wine. OPCs may be up to fifty times more potent than vitamin E and twenty times more potent than vitamin C in terms of their bioavailable antioxidant activity.

Grape seed extract is marketed as a skin revitalizer, a treatment for allergic conditions and a heart disease preventative. It has powerful antioxidants that may combat harm caused by free radicals in your body, which can damage your cells. Grape seed extract side effects have not been reported in the medical literature, but very few human studies have been done. In one study with cancer patients given radiation therapy and grape seed extract 100 mg three times a day orally for 6 months, no major adverse reaction were reported.

Theoretically, anticoagulant or antiplatelet medications could cause drug interactions with grape seed extract. Such interactions may occur if the supplement is taken in combination with aspirin, heparin, nonsteroidal anti-inflammatory drugs, or warfarin. These interactions could possibly increase your risk of bleeding, including dangerous internal bleeding. However, the risk may be more serious with potent prescription drugs and less dangerous with drugs like NSAIDs.

Grape seed extract is considered nontoxic and has been extremely well tolerated in clinical trials. Grape seed side effects are rare. Those reported include mild stomach upset, dizziness, or itchy rash. No known grape seed extract contraindications. No known drug interactions.

There is no reported toxicity associated with standard dosages of grape seed extract. But information regarding safety and efficacy in pregnancy and lactation is lacking. Therefore, pregnant and breast feeding mothers should not supplement with grape seed extract, as its safety on developing babies and infants has not been accurately assessed.

In addition, caution is advised when administering supplements containing grape seed polyphenols at the same time as vitamin C to hypertensive patients because increases in blood pressure may occur.
